BART to provide free tickets to military personnel on leave


advertisement

Bay Area Rapid Transit (BART) has come up with a way to honor military personnel who are serving their country in Iraq and Afghanistan: a free ticket. Yesterday, the agency announced it’s implementing a one-year pilot program through which it will provide a free $50 ticket to eligible active-duty military personnel who are on leave in the Bay Area from Operation Iraqi Freedom or Operation Enduring Freedom.

BART has allocated $50,000 for the program — the first of its kind for a U.S. transportation agency, according to BART. Personnel with a valid leave order from their respective military branch are eligible for free tickets.
